The Machine

The Machine is not some external villain.

It’s what happens when the Spark forgets.

It is the system of internalized distortion. The voices, rules, roles, and patterns you absorbed to survive.

It is urgency. Shame. Camouflage. Obedience. Perfection.

It is the pressure to keep going even when you’re falling apart.

It is the whisper that says: You must earn your worth.

That your pain must be useful.

That who you are is too much.

Or not enough.

In Ash & Signal, we don’t treat the Machine as imaginary. We recognize it as an inner structure built from real conditioning — from families, systems, trauma, culture, religion, capitalism, identity survival.

You didn’t choose it.

But you can see it.

And once seen, it can be dismantled.
